Production & Operations focuses on designing, managing, and improving production processes and business operations, as well as manufacturing technologies and supply chains. The role involves working with modern systems such as SAP and dashboards, some of which are self-programmed. This is a cross-functional and international environment that offers performance-driven, diverse challenges and exciting projects.

You can look forward to these exciting tasks:

  • Operation of a small number of machines and workstations within a production line according to work instructions, including applicable Quality and HSE guidelines
  • Removal of products from the machines - Assembly of components - Monitoring of processes, inspection of quality/safety characteristics
  • Escalation of any detected concerns and problems (Quality and Safety) in line with escalation procedures
  • Performing workstation 5S activities and total production maintenance (TPM) in line with standard operating procedures
  • Involvement in continuous improvement process

This is what you bring to us:

  • Results-oriented team player, excellent attendance, high energy level and good attention to detail
  • Must be able to work required hours
  • Demonstrates creativity, initiative, and problem-solving skills
  • Willingness to be cross trained on various processes, machines and products


What we offer you:

  • Competitive pay $18.75 (Plus shift premium) 
  • Health coverage for you and your family
  • Generous number of vacation days each year
  • Paid sick time
  • 401k with company match
